All the shots here were taken with film cameras unless otherwise stated. Basically, a bunch of nikons and older nikkormats and the like, as well as a funky Soviet 6X6 medium format and a home-made medium format pinhole camera. Everything is scanned, photoshoped (the scanning takes away from the original properties of the picture) and uploaded.
